I hate to say it, but just throwing the ball for the sake of throwing the ball against defenses like Burg, Valley, etc wont work. I'm sorry, but those teams are full of enough athletes in the secondary that will go man-to-man on the unproven West receivers, and blitz the untested West QB all night long. It will put even more pressure on the running game to produce, instead of opening the field up which is your desired goal. I understand you want the Siders to incorporate the pass into the offense more, but mid-season against the best teams on your schedule isn't the time to start. If its going to happen, it needs to be developed in the off-season, just like the other programs do. You can't just go away from what your kids do best in the middle of the season due to an unexpected slow start. West is still West, and they aren't going to be a pushover for ANYONE on this league.
